# SteadyBuild Depot

[SteadyBuild Depot](https://hardware.mock.shop/llms.txt) is a [mock.shop](https://www.mock.shop/) sample store for building against a hardware and tool shop before a real Shopify store is ready. The catalog includes tape measures, laser levels, power tool batteries, rolling tool chests, carpenter belts, deck screws, and work lights. There are 60 products across five collections. Each product has one option selector; its label and choices depend on the item.

mock.shop is an auth-free Shopify Storefront GraphQL API backed by sample reference stores. Find out more about [mock.shop sample stores](https://www.shopify.com/blog/mock-shop).

## Example SteadyBuild Depot query

Here’s an example GraphQL `POST` request that retrieves options and variant prices for one product from <https://hardware.mock.shop/api>:

```bash
curl https://hardware.mock.shop/api \
  -H 'Content-Type: application/json' \
  --data '{"query":"{ product(handle: \"durable-handheld-measuring-tape\") { id title options { name values } variants(first: 50) { pageInfo { hasNextPage } nodes { id title selectedOptions { name value } price { amount currencyCode } compareAtPrice { amount currencyCode } availableForSale } } } }"}'
```

This query retrieves Durable Handheld Measuring Tape, including option values, variant IDs, selected options, availability, and current and compare-at prices. Use the selected variant’s ID and price when adding it to a cart.

The endpoint doesn't require authentication or an access token. Read <https://hardware.mock.shop/llms.txt> for catalog details and store-specific instructions.

## What this catalog lets you test

Build a hardware shop where customers find measuring tools, fasteners, batteries, and workshop storage without every product using the same size selector. SteadyBuild Depot gives you 60 products across five collections for that broader browse. The Durable Handheld Measuring Tape offers Standard or High-Precision Accuracy at the same price, making a straightforward selected-variant cart example. Other items have their own saved options, such as capacity or finish. Use those values on individual product pages rather than assuming they prove compatibility between tools, batteries, or accessories.

## Build with an AI coding tool

To build a hardware and tool storefront with SteadyBuild Depot using Claude, ChatGPT, Cursor, Lovable, or another AI assistant, copy the prompt below. It gives the assistant the store domain and directs it to the catalog instructions before it starts writing code.

```text
Build me a Hydrogen storefront using hardware.mock.shop as the store domain. Setup instructions: hardware.mock.shop/llms.txt
```

Shopify also provides a [mock.shop starter project](https://github.com/Shopify/mock-shop-starter): a Hydrogen storefront with product pages, collection browsing, and a working cart already connected to mock.shop. You or your AI coding tool can customize this code instead of building those pieces from scratch.

Follow the repository’s setup instructions, then set `PUBLIC_STORE_DOMAIN=hardware.mock.shop` in `.env` and restart the dev server to use SteadyBuild Depot’s catalog. Leave `PUBLIC_STOREFRONT_API_TOKEN` empty; mock.shop doesn’t require a token.

## Move to a real Shopify store

mock.shop uses fictional, read-only catalog data. Cart operations work, and checkout is mocked: no payment is taken and no real order is placed. The Customer Account API isn’t supported.

When you’re ready to launch, point your storefront at a Shopify store and add that store’s public Storefront API token. If you don’t have a Shopify store yet, [start a Shopify free trial](https://www.shopify.com/free-trial) to create one.

Read the [mock.shop developer documentation](https://shopify.dev/docs/storefronts/headless/mock-shop) for setup and migration details.

## Store facts

| | |
|---|---|
| Store handle | `hardware` |
| Catalog model | Hardware and tool shop |
| Products | 60 |
| Collections | 5 |
| Categories | 16 |
| Variants per product | 2–3 |
| Compare-at prices | 8 products |
| Requires shipping | All products |
| API endpoint | <https://hardware.mock.shop/api> |
| Store instructions | <https://hardware.mock.shop/llms.txt> |
| Browser preview | <https://hardware.hydrogen.mock.shop> |
